The invention provides a combined type ion lens ion wind generation device. The combined type ion lens ion wind generation device comprises an emitting electrode, wherein the emitting electrode comprises a plurality of electrode plates made of a conducting material; plate surfaces of the plurality of electrode plates are located in the front-back vertical direction; a row of discharging needles are uniformly arrayed on a backward side face of each electrode plate along the vertical direction; each discharging needle backward stretches out along the horizontal direction; a front lens plate is arranged behind the emitting electrode; a plate surface of the front lens plate is located in the left-back vertical direction; a plurality of grades of circular front lens through holes are uniformly arrayed on the a plate surface of the front lens plate along the vertical direction; the backward side face of each electrode plate faces one row of the front lens through holes; and a needle point of each discharging needle points to the middle part of one front lens through hole. The invention aims at providing the combined type ion lens ion wind generation device, which can be applied to an outdoor open space system, can be used for reducing the concentration of particulate matters at the periphery of a region of the device can be reduced within relatively short time, does not need to be driven by utilizing a draught fan in a purification process and has extremely low power consumption.

[0001] The invention relates to an air purification device, in particular to a combined ion lens ion wind generating device. Background technique

[0002] Emission of particulate matter into the air will cause severe smog weather. Therefore, controlling the emission of particulate matter pollutant sources is the only way to control smog. Research on high-efficiency, low-cost, and cheap air purification technologies will help control the spread of pollutants and create a clean environment. Electrostatic precipitator technology has been widely used in the purification of particulate matter in industrial and civil fields. In practical applications, a wire-plate structure is usually used. The corona is generated by the corona wire, and the ionized air generates electrons and ions, and then the particles are charged by the electron avalanche, and under the action of the electric field, the particles are collected on the dust collection plate. [0033] Research has found that corona eddy currents will appear around the cathode line of the electrostatic precipitator. This phenomenon will reduce the dust removal efficiency in the process of industrial dust removal. Try to avoid or reduce the eddy current intensity.

[0034] The invention uses the "traction" effect of the electric field to make the eddy current produce directional movement, and the ion lens effect of the lens plate makes the ion wind form a directional secondary jet, and the ions in the airflow can be pushed far away without a fan, so that many Accumulation and deposition of particulate matter in the air over a wide range. This principle and structure can be used to make silent household air purifiers, and can also be used in multiple fields such as air purification in atmospheric environments and industrial flue gas treatment by integrating multiple components.
